WebBefore you start tying your first fly, you need to know the size of the hook necessary for that pattern. The most common fly hooks range from size 1 to size 32. The lower the number, the larger the hook (just like with tippet and leader, or wire gauge). Sizes are determined by the length of metal used to make the hook. WebJan 7, 2024 · Turned-up eyes are used for live bait snells. Anglers use straight eyes for all baits and lead shot rigs. Turned-down eyes are used with crawler rigs. The most popular eyes found on hooks are the straight eye. The straight eye allows for more room in the gap and increases leverage on your hook set.

There are a … WebThe names of bass fishing hooks will vary depending on the fishing tactics used. For hard lures like crank and jerk baits, treble hooks are often used. For plastic worms and creature baits, worm hook or Extra Wide Gap (EWG) worm hook designs may be used. For live bait, baitholder hooks are common.
